Our Youth Enrichment program will expose youth in the South Fulton, College Park, East Point, Clayton County, and neighboring areas in a variety of tech courses. Each month will focus on a variety of tech courses that consist of Game Design, Computer Programming, Cybersecurity, Engineering, AI, Robotics, Math, and other STEM related subjects. Students will have the opportunity to build and design functional hardware and software. Each month, we will offer 2-3 classes that will meet once a week.

Here are the following lessons we will cover each month:

January: Intro to AI

  • What is Artificial Intelligence? Ethics of Artificial Intelligence.
  • Digital Design
  • Using Artificial Intelligence to enhance art and design


February: 3D Engineering and Design

  • Engineering and the Engineering Design Process
  • Building Simple Machines and Engineering Models
  • 3D Engineering and Bridge Design


March: Intro to Game Design

  • Game Design fundamentals
  • Storyboarding in Game Design
  • Game Design Graphics and Animation


April: Cybersecurity & Internet Safety

  • Teach youth the fundamentals of Coding and Ethical Hacking principles.
  • Educate youth on protecting themselves online and avoiding cyberscams.
  • Hands-on exercises that provide effective Internet Safety strategies for school and home.

Kids Next Code was founded in 2016 we are a tech program that provides support in coding, game design, and engineering. Our founder Travis A. Reeves has worked in IT for over 10 years with various companies such as Sun-Trust, Coca-Cola, and the Georgia Lotto he leveraged his passion for IT, Education, and Entrepreneurship to be a resource for students in disenfranchised communities to facilitate the expansion of their career opportunities. Although our focus is in the youth realm, we support all ages in their tech journey through virtual and in-person courses year-round. We have taught STEM and tech-related classes such as coding, web design, mobile app design, and robotics to over 600 students (ages 5-18) in Georgia and New York. We have partnerships with Dekalb County Sheriff's department, Clayton County & Fulton County Library branch, and many more!
